General Info:

Track Name: 18

Album: Four

Release Date: The album “Four” was released on November 17, 2014.

Writing & Production:

Written By: The song was written by Ed Sheeran and Passenger (Michael Rosenberg).

Produced By: The track was produced by John Ryan, Julian Bunetta, and Ed Sheeran.

Song Characteristics:

Genre: “18” is primarily a pop song with heartfelt, romantic lyrics.

Lyrical Content: The lyrics talk about a youthful romance that has remained in the singer’s memory, signifying a love that was experienced at 18.

Vocals: All members – Harry Styles, Liam Payne, Louis Tomlinson, Niall Horan, and Zayn Malik, share vocal duties on this track.

Chart Performance & Reception:

Commercial Performance: “Four” was a commercial success, but “18” was not released as a single, so it didn’t chart individually in many regions.

Critical Reception: The song received positive reviews, with critics praising its emotional depth and the band’s vocal performance.

Notable Performances:

On Tour: “18” was part of the setlist during the “On The Road Again” Tour in 2015.

Trivia:

Ed Sheeran’s Influence: Ed Sheeran, a well-known singer-songwriter, has penned several tracks for One Direction, and his emotional, storytelling style is evident in “18.”

Fan-Favorite: Despite not being a single, “18” became a favorite among the One Direction fanbase.
